Output 289f219a6b67aaa4cce74d6addcc6dd95ce82782324677ce9d95afcf34ee9f4a:0

value
21290211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852a53c52a5022141b0be9716c1354851fadafe0 OP_EQUAL
address
3Dq8W1DR7nfiTK8Q3Jy7P41eiVFa4HXhLL
transaction
289f219a6b67aaa4cce74d6addcc6dd95ce82782324677ce9d95afcf34ee9f4a
spent
true